What is Warning?
A weather warning means that a weather hazard is occurring, imminent, or likely. In other words, severe weather is happening now, developing as we speak, and is minutes away. This weather hazard poses a threat to life and property.
Schedule a Demo Today
A new era is starting with fundamentally new forecasting with unprecedented precision!
Contact UsGlossary
Thermodynamic changes occurring within a system without any exchange of heat with the surroundings. In the atmosphere, changes...
Weather is the day-to-day meteorological conditions that happen in our atmosphere. Weather can change within minutes, which...
A weather watch means there is a risk of weather hazards in the near future, which could pose a threat to life/property....
Observation of the sky from the observer's location where there are no clouds, and there is no obstruction to visibility....
The occurrence of storms resulting from the horizontal advection of cold air at high levels or the horizontal advection of...
Although it is also used for light winds, it is the general name given to the daily cyclical winds that occur mostly between...
A condition in which the stratification of the atmosphere depends on both air temperature and pressure, and where surfaces...
A long, narrow region in the atmosphere that transport water vapor, like a river in the sky.
Bright and dark rays with changing colors and contrast in the sky. These rays become visible due to the reflection of atmospheric...
A deviation from the normal or expected value in atmospheric or climatic conditions, often used in meteorology to identify...

